Begin by selecting a vibrant jade plant from a reputable nursery. Examine the leaves and trunk for any signs of damage. Choose a pot that is slightly larger than the root ball and has good drainage. Use a well-draining bonsai soil mix to promote proper root development.

Water your jade bonsai frequently, but avoid overwatering. Allow the soil to dry out between waterings. Place your bonsai in a location that receives indirect sunlight for several hours each day.

Feed your jade bonsai with a balanced bonsai fertilizer during the growing season.

Prune and shape your jade bonsai regularly to maintain its desired form. Be sure to use sharp, clean pruning tools. With dedication, you can cultivate a stunning jade bonsai that will be a source of joy for years to come.

Nurturing a Jade Bonsai: Soil Secrets Revealed

Achieving success with your jade bonsai isn't solely about mastering pruning techniques. It's about providing the perfect foundation for growth - its soil. Jades thrive in well-draining, nutrient-rich mixtures that mimic their natural habitat. Opt for a combination of porous ingredients like coarse sand, perlite, and akadama clay to ensure optimal drainage and prevent root rot. These components create an airy environment that allows the roots to breathe and prevents water from pooling at the base of the tree. Remember, your jade bonsai's soil is its foundation for a healthy, vibrant life.

  • Adding a sprinkle of organic matter like composted pine bark or leaf mold can provide valuable nutrients and further enhance the soil's structure.
  • Consistent checking the soil moisture is crucial. Allow the top inch to dry out completely between waterings, as overwatering can be detrimental to your bonsai.
